Profile

Headquartered in Sydney, Australia, Melbana Energy Limited is an oil and gas exploration company actively developing projects in both Cuba and Australia. Its portfolio includes a full 100% interest in the Tassie Shoal Methanol and LNG project located in Australia, alongside complete ownership of Cuba's Santa Cruz oil field. The company also holds a 100% stake in the WA-544-P and NT/P87 permits, covering approximately 4,000 square kilometers within the Petrel sub-basin. Further expanding its Cuban presence, Melbana possesses a 30% interest in Block 9, an area spanning 2,344 square kilometers. Founded in 1994, the company was known as MEO Australia Limited until November 2016, when it rebranded to its current name.
